If the jacuzzi tube is fiberglass... I am not sure it would work... too many holes and curves... the mosaic tiles would have to be really small.... like penny tile.. a construction adhesive like Liquid Nails might work to carefully (work one sheet at a time) apply the tile and then once the glue has cured thoroughly... grout as usual over that... you would have to sand the fiberglass to give it the tooth and it would also have to be cleaned really well to get rid of any soap scum or residue...
And BE AWARE... this would be a one way trip... that once the tiles are applied... and if you don't like the results... your only option at that time would be to replace the tub.
